The author considers locally compact quantum groups introduced by \textit{S.~Vaes} and \textit{J.~Kustermans} [Math. Scand. 92, No. 1, 68--92 (2003; Zbl 1034.46067)]; such a group, \({\mathbb G}\), is a von Neumann algebra with an additional co-multiplication structure. Using the GNS-construction, one can define the corresponding \(C^*\)-algebra \(C_0({\mathbb G})\) by taking the norm closure of a representation of \({\mathbb G}\) on a Hilbert space. In the case \({\mathbb G}=G\) is a (classical) locally compact group, there exists a canonical compactification in terms of the \(C^*\)-subalgebras of algebra \(C_0(G)\); the compactification turns \(G\) into a semi-group. In the paper under review, the author extends the classical construction to the quantum groups using the \(C^*\)-subalgebras of the algebra \(C_0({\mathbb G})\); basic properties of such a compactification are established.
